那么怎么办呢?就在我为难的时候,我朋友将另一台同环境的服务上的librt.so.1这个文件拷贝到了此服务上面,然后再次运行yum,结果这次yum运行正常
总结:我想应该是librt.so.1这个文件出错导致的。
后来我查了一下这个文件,原来librt.so是glibc中对real-time部分的支持库。
Linux 下有动态库和静态库,动态库以.so为扩展名,静态库以.a为扩展名。如果感兴趣的可以自己再去查看更多的关于这个文件的知识。
其实此文档中已经包含了如何正确的升级Python,可以参考
更多YUM相关教程见以下内容:
CentOS及Red Hat Linux安装yum源
RedHat7.0配置本地yum源